David Chinner wrote:
> Improve metadata I/O merging in the elevator
>
> Change all async metadata buffers to use [READ|WRITE]_META I/O types
> so that the I/O doesn't get issued immediately. This allows merging
> of adjacent metadata requests but still prioritises them over bulk
> data. This shows a 10-15% improvement in sequential create speed of
> small files.

> Don't include the log buffers in this classification - leave them
> as sync types so they are issued immediately.
